Create a Turquoise Plaid and Cushion with Acrylic Yarn

You'll Need:
1200g of 100% acryl yarn of turquoise color (240m/100g);
Circle knitting needles 4.5.
Size:
1.4 х 2.0 m.Used Patterns:
Rib:
2 knit sts and 2 purls in turn;Cables:
Knit according to the scheme, where only right side rows are stated, and wrong-side rows follow the ornament.Instructions:
Plaid:
Cast on 208 sts + 2 selvedge sts. Knit 5 cm with rib. Then, allocate the sts as follows: 1 selvedge st, repeat the pattern 8 times, 1 selvedge st. Continue working until the total length of work is 195 cm. Switch to rib for 5 cm height, then bind off the sts.
Cushion:
Cast on 80 sts + 2 selvedge sts. Knit 5 cm with rib. Then, allocate the sts as follows: 1 selvedge st, repeat the pattern 3 times, 1 selvedge st. Continue working until the total length of work is 80 cm. Fold the obtained stripe and make side seams.
